Polish virtual education fairs to be held on Thursday
By JT - Apr 19,2021 - Last updated at Apr 19,2021
AMMAN — Poland will hold virtual education fairs dedicated to the Arab world on April 22, according to a Polish embassy statement.
The Polish embassy and the Polish National Agency for Academic Exchange (NAWA) invited high school and university students from Jordan to attend the virtual event dedicated to studies in Poland to visit: www.rsgp.webexpo.pl Thursday between 8am and 4pm. Polish virtual education fairs offer opportunity for direct contact with more than 50 leading Polish universities, the statement said.
Interested students are invited to visit the event’s Facebook page for more information.
